An emulator is a software program that mimics the hardware of a video game console (like a GameCube or PlayStation 2) on a different system (like your Windows PC or Android phone). Emulators themselves are completely legal. They are complex pieces of software that allow you to play games from older consoles on modern hardware.

The ROM scene is unregulated. Many sites upload files labeled "RE4.gcm" that are actually executable viruses. Because ROM files are large (1.4GB), users often download them from torrents or file lockers filled with malicious ads. Security firms have noted a rise in "cryptojacking" scripts on ROM download pages that use your CPU to mine Bitcoin while you look for the download button. No, downloading a ROM from the internet is

Many retro gamers argue that since Capcom no longer sells the original GameCube disc (they sell ports or remakes), the preservation of the original code is a matter of history. The "Abandonware" argument suggests that if a company refuses to sell a specific version of a game in a modern format, archiving it is ethical, even if not strictly legal. Each major platform (GameCube, PS2, Wii) has its own unique build of the game. They may feature different control schemes, bonus content, or graphical nuances. The community also creates "highly compressed" ROM versions to save storage space, though these should be treated with caution.
